Customer Service Associate

As a Customer Service Associate, you will play a vital role in our company's success by delivering exceptional customer service. Your primary focus will be on managing customer inquiries and ensuring a smooth payment process. You will be the voice of our company, representing us with professionalism and a customer-centric approach.
  • Handle customer inquiries and complaints via phone, email, or chat, providing timely and accurate responses.
  • Collect pending Equated Monthly Installments (EMIs) for the current month, ensuring timely and accurate payments.
  • Guide customers through the payment process, offering clear and concise instructions.
  • Maintain accurate records of customer interactions and payments, ensuring data integrity.
  • Provide product information and educate customers on our offerings, features, and benefits.
  • Identify and escalate potential payment issues or disputes, working closely with the relevant teams to resolve them.
  • Build strong relationships with customers, ensuring their satisfaction and loyalty.
  • Stay updated with product knowledge and industry trends to provide accurate and relevant information.
  • Collaborate with the sales team to cross-sell and upsell products, contributing to the company's growth.
  • Ensure compliance with company policies and procedures, maintaining a high standard of customer service.
  • High school diploma or equivalent; relevant certifications in customer service or sales are preferred.
  • 1-2 years of experience in a customer service or sales role, preferably in a financial services or collections environment.
  •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written, with the ability to build rapport with customers.
  • Strong problem-solving and conflict resolution skills, with a customer-centric approach.
  • Proficiency in using CRM systems and Microsoft Office suite, particularly Excel.
  • Ability to work independently and manage a high volume of customer interactions.
  • Excellent time management and organizational skills, with the ability to prioritize tasks.
  • A proactive and positive attitude, with a passion for delivering exceptional customer service.
  • Willingness to learn and adapt to new systems and processes.
  • Fluency in English is mandatory; proficiency in additional languages is a plus.
